The cheapest way to get from Pointe du Lac to Paris is to line 8 subway which costs €3 and takes 25 min.
The fastest way to get from Pointe du Lac to Paris is to taxi which takes 18 min and costs €30 - €40.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Pointe du Lac and arriving at Bercy - Aréna. Services depart every three h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 33 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Pointe du Lac and arriving at Bastille.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 25 min.
The distance between Pointe du Lac and Paris is 13 km. The road distance is 16 km.
The best way to get from Pointe du Lac to Paris without a car is to line 8 subway which takes 25 min and costs €3.
The line 8 subway from Pointe du Lac to Bastille takes 25 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.

What companies run services between Pointe du Lac, France and Paris, France?
RATP Metro operates a subway from Pointe du Lac to Bastille every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 25 min. Alternatively, Bord de Marne operates a bus from Pointe du Lac to Bercy - Aréna every 3 hours, and the journey takes 33 min.
